Saraki’s 53rd birthday message to Nigerians: 2016 will be better

Senate President, Dr. Bukola Saraki, on Saturday, assured Nigerians of policies that would transform the nation’s economy in 2016.
Saraki gave the assurance in a statement by Mr Bamikole Omishore, his Special Assistant on Media.
The statement said the senate president gave the assurance at special prayer in Ilorin to mark his 53rd birthday.

He said that the current administration was committed to making lives more comfortable for Nigerians.

Saraki said that the APC-led federal government would continue to formulate economic policies that would be beneficial to all.

He urged Nigerians to be patient with the Buhari administration, adding that the Senate under his leadership would be committed to improved socio- economic development of the country.

He said that his birthday was not celebrated with fanfare due to the global economic situation affecting the country.

“As I said, the challenging situation globally, in the country and in the states did not allow for celebration.

“We have great challenges ahead as a country. So, we have to dedicate ourselves to improving the situation for the common good,” he said.

Saraki solicited the support of all Nigerians in the task ahead, saying that the legislature was more committed to serving the people to realise their collective aspirations and goals.

He commended the people of Kwara for their unflinching support since his emergence as President of the Senate and promised that he would not disappoint them and Nigerians.
